Output 63bc8f25a71efd3185066795c9242d84ee88bcedb905bf5e00bf55a6b5dbfcd8: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 102380f9b808146b7f52a28d426d97de92f69b58 OP_EQUAL
address
33AMGThAzyk3bPFiUueyYNP2DZopYDR4q2
transaction
63bc8f25a71efd3185066795c9242d84ee88bcedb905bf5e00bf55a6b5dbfcd8
spent
true